Before you spend money on a designer tub or marble counter, consider if you’ll see the full return on this investment. Also, some renovations are very expensive such as increasing the space of the bathroom. Consider if you really need to knock down a load-bearing wall – the extra room might not cover the cost of the bathroom renovation. If you’re not sure, consult a real estate agent in the area who is more in tune with the values of your area.
Finally, you should have a professional and licensed contractor take care of a big job or bathroom renovation, but for smaller jobs, you’d be surprised at the money you can save by doing the job yourself. Some are pretty obvious, like installing new fixtures, but did you know that most new toilets can be installed without the expensive labor? A toilet installation is a relatively simple do-it-yourself project, and might not need the full labor costs of a difficult bathroom renovation.

A bathroom renovation might be a job that can dramatically increase the value of your house, but beware that many costs can be associated and you might not get as much out of the investment as you put into as labor and material costs. Trying to find the right balance is the ultimate key to the bathroom renovation that you need.
